    Hi, I am planning my trip, staying at Disneyland Hotel from 28 September for 4 nights, and wanted to see if the extra magic hour to gain early access to the theme parks will be brought back then?

    Hi Amanda!

    Welcome to planDisney! Thank you so much for sending this Disneyland Resort hotel question our way. I'm happy to be your planEAR today!

    At the current time we have not hEARd any set date about if or when Extra Magic Hours and Magic Mornings will return to Disneyland Resort. These special park pre-opening benefits are extended to Guests of Disneyland Resort Hotels as well as Disneyland Good Neighbor Hotels. The best bet to be sure to hEAR about any updates would be to pay attention to the Disney Parks Blog as they're the source of the most magical news straight from Mickey himself. You can even follow them on your various social media channels so you'll never miss a post! Rest assured that if you go ahead and book a room-only reservation or Disneyland Resort Hotel Vacation Package, it can always be upgraded to include whatever update or new offer has been released between the time of booking and the time of your arrival. Should those benefits come back before you visit Mickey's house, reach out to the Disneyland Hotel Reservation Cast Members who will see what they can do.

    One thing I'll say is I was recently in the parks a few months ago, and even with the addition of the brand new Disney Genie+ ticket add-on option, neither Disneyland Park nor Disney California Adventure Park felt overly crowded for the first few hours of the day. There's a saying that the local Angelinos like to sleep in and arrive after the work hours leaving the morning less busy, and that's going to be my wish for you, Amanda!
